New York, New York – Renowned psychiatrist Barbara Bartlik, MD, has distinguished herself over more than 30 years in private practice in Manhattan, emerging as a leading expert in psychiatry, sexual health, and integrative medicine. Dr. Bartlik offers a wide range of services tailored to individuals and couples grappling with psychiatric, relational, and sexual health issues. Her commitment to accessible care has driven her pioneering efforts in telehealth, allowing her to extend her healing reach beyond the vibrant streets of New York City.
In her practice, Dr. Bartlik specializes in a diverse array of mental health challenges, including depression, anxiety, post-traumatic stress disorder, women’s health concerns, and sexual dysfunction. Employing an evidence-based, holistic, and integrative approach, she combines traditional psychiatric methods with lifestyle modifications, nutritional guidance, genetic insights, detoxification strategies, and innovative neurostimulation techniques to foster optimal health and well-being.
Dr. Bartlik’s impressive academic credentials include an Undergraduate Degree from the University of Hartford (1977) and a Medical Degree from the Albert Einstein College of Medicine (1981), where she studied neurology under the late Dr. Oliver Sacks. She completed her psychiatry residency and research fellowship at New York University Medical Center/Bellevue Hospital (now NYU Langone Health) and trained alongside the late pioneering sex therapist Dr. Helen Singer Kaplan. Additionally, she has provided care for severely mentally ill patients at Manhattan and Rockland Psychiatric Centers, part of the New York State Office of Mental Health.
As a board-certified psychiatrist through the American Board of Psychiatry and Neurology, Dr. Bartlik also holds certifications in integrative medicine from the American Board of Physician Specialties and in sexology from the American Board of Sexology. Her extensive expertise has made her a valuable member of the voluntary faculty at Weill Cornell Medical College and a member of the voluntary staff at both New York-Presbyterian Hospital and Lenox Hill Hospital.
Recognized as a leading authority in her field, Dr. Bartlik is a sought-after speaker at local, national, and international events, frequently appearing on talk shows and podcasts. Her remarkable contributions to psychiatry and integrative medicine have garnered her numerous accolades, including designation as a Distinguished Life Fellow of the American Psychiatric Association in 2019. She has also been consistently recognized in Castle Connolly’s Top Doctors list, receiving the Regional Top Doctors Award from 2019 to 2022 and being named among the Top Doctors in the New York Metro Area from 2019 to 2024. Furthermore, Dr. Bartlik has been featured in New York Magazine’s Best Doctors from 2019 to 2023 and has earned the Super Doctor title from The New York Times Magazine from 2021 to 2023.
In addition to her clinical practice, Dr. Bartlik is a co-editor and author of the comprehensive textbook Integrative Sexual Health (2018), published by Oxford University Press.
